Web12 feb. 2024 · If an async method doesn't use an await operator to mark a suspension point, the method executes as a synchronous method does, despite the async modifier. The compiler issues a warning for such methods. async and await are contextual keywords. For more information and examples, see the following topics: async await Return types and …

Web16 dec. 2024 · The await operator returns control to the calling environment while the asynchronous operation is performed. The code after this statement acts as a continuation that runs when the asynchronous operation has completed.
